Financial Operations Manager/Assistant Controller (part-time 28/hrs per week)

The Finance Operations Manager is responsible for a major portion of finance activities for several departments/centers who report through the Academic Vice President. This is a finance position that manages some or all the following business processes: expense management, financial accounting, budget management, accounts payable, accounts receivable, business assets, grants management, projects, and gifts management. The position reports directly to the Academic Controller.
